Sheree H.

I have experimented with extentions. I like using hair glue. Its simple and the glue will come out without hair loss. I just did it myself. Used human hair tracks then cut little strips, part the hair put the glue on the track then hold it down and use a hair dryer to dry the glue. Super easy.
